How Long Does a Patent Last?

Everything You Need to Know Before It Expires

Patent protection does not last forever, and the exact length depends on the type of patent, the fees you pay, and where in the world you filed.

At a Glance:

  • A U.S. utility patent lasts 20 years from the filing date, subject to maintenance fees.
  • A U.S. design patent lasts 15 years from the grant date, with no maintenance fees.
  • A provisional application is not a patent; it holds your spot for 12 months.
  • Patent term adjustment and patent term extension can add time; a terminal disclaimer can subtract it.
  • Maintenance fees are due at 3.5, 7.5, and 11.5 years, or the patent lapses early.
  • A U.S. patent does not protect you abroad; international filings follow their own rules.

The patent system trades a limited monopoly for public disclosure, so every patent is built to expire. Understanding that timeline helps inventors, businesses, and researchers plan around the moment an invention becomes free for everyone to use.

The Basics: What Is a Patent and Why Does Duration Matter?

A patent is a legal grant from a government patent office that gives an inventor the exclusive right to stop others from making, using, or selling an invention for a limited time. Duration matters because once that window closes, the patented invention enters the public domain and anyone can use it freely.

In the United States, patents are issued by the U.S. Patent and Trademark Office (USPTO). The exclusive right a patent confers is the right to exclude others from making, using, offering for sale, or selling the invention within the country. That right is the entire point of patent protection, and it has an expiration date by design.

There are three main filing categories inventors deal with. A utility patent covers how an invention works, such as a machine, process, or chemical compound. A design patent protects the ornamental appearance of a product rather than its function. A provisional patent application is a lower-cost placeholder that establishes an early filing date without starting a formal examination.

Standard Patent Terms in the United States

In the United States, a utility patent lasts 20 years from its filing date, while a design patent lasts 15 years from its grant date. A provisional application is not a patent at all; it holds your place for 12 months before a full application must follow.

For utility patents filed on or after June 8, 1995, the patent term runs 20 years from the earliest U.S. non-provisional filing date. Provisional applications and foreign priority filings do not count against that 20-year clock. This is why the filing date and the priority date can differ: the priority date marks your place in line for examination, but the standard term is generally measured from the non-provisional filing date.

Design patents work differently. Following U.S. accession to the Hague Agreement, design patents from applications filed on or after May 13, 2015 last 15 years from the date of grant, up from the earlier 14-year term. They carry no maintenance fees.

Patent typeTerm lengthMeasured fromMaintenance fees?
Utility patent20 yearsFiling dateYes
Design patent15 yearsGrant dateNo
Provisional application12 monthsFiling dateNo (it is not a patent)

A common misconception is that a provisional application becomes a patent on its own. It does not. It buys an inventor up to a year of “patent pending” status to refine the invention before committing to the full patent application process.

Patent Term Adjustment and Patent Term Extension: Getting Extra Time

Two mechanisms can lengthen a patent beyond its standard term. Patent term adjustment adds days to compensate for USPTO processing delays, and patent term extension restores time lost to FDA regulatory review for products like drugs and medical devices. A terminal disclaimer, by contrast, can shorten a term.

Patent term adjustment (PTA) applies when the USPTO takes too long. If the office misses certain internal deadlines, such as exceeding three years to issue a patent, the lost time is added back to the term. PTA matters most for inventors whose applications sit in examination for years.

Patent term extension (PTE) is built for industries where regulatory approval eats into the effective patent life. Under the 1984 Hatch-Waxman Act, a pharmaceutical company can recover part of the time a drug spent in clinical trials and FDA review. The restoration is capped: a single patent can gain no more than five years, and the total term cannot exceed 14 years after FDA approval. Only one patent per approved product qualifies, and the application must be filed within 60 days of approval.

A terminal disclaimer moves in the opposite direction. A patent owner files one, often to overcome a double-patenting rejection, and in doing so agrees that the later patent will expire at the same time as a related one. It can shorten the term rather than extend it.

Maintenance Fees: The Cost of Keeping a Patent Alive

A U.S. utility patent does not stay in force on its own. The patent holder must pay maintenance fees at 3.5, 7.5, and 11.5 years after the patent is granted. Miss a deadline and the patent lapses early, sending the invention into the public domain ahead of schedule.

These payments are a deliberate filter. They ask patent owners to decide, at three points across the life of the patent, whether the protection is still worth the cost. An invention generating no revenue often gets abandoned at the first or second milestone, which is why valuable but dormant patents sometimes lapse by accident inside large portfolios.

The U.S. utility patent maintenance schedule:

  • First fee: due by 3.5 years after grant
  • Second fee: due by 7.5 years after grant
  • Third fee: due by 11.5 years after grant

Design patents have no maintenance fees in the United States. In many European countries the structure is different again, with renewal fees paid annually rather than at set milestones, so the cost of holding a patent rises year over year.

International Patent Duration: The PCT, EPO, and Beyond

A U.S. patent only protects an invention inside the United States. International protection requires filing in each country or region, often through the Patent Cooperation Treaty or the European Patent Office. The standard term abroad is usually 20 years from filing, but renewal rules and fees differ by country.

The Patent Cooperation Treaty (PCT) does not grant a patent. A PCT application is a single international filing that buys time, giving applicants roughly 30 to 31 months from the priority date to decide which countries to pursue. After that, the applicant must enter the “national phase” in each chosen jurisdiction, and each patent office examines the application under its own patent law.

In Europe, the European Patent Convention lets applicants seek protection through the European Patent Office (EPO). A granted European patent runs up to 20 years from its filing date, but it must be validated and renewed country by country, with annual renewal fees due in each territory where it stays in force. The European Union also offers a supplementary protection certificate, a counterpart to U.S. patent term extension that adds time for medicines and plant-protection products delayed by regulatory approval.

The practical takeaway: patent rights are territorial. Securing global protection means managing multiple expiration dates, multiple fee schedules, and multiple sets of rules at once.

Patent Expiration and What It Means for Innovation

When a patent expires, the invention enters the public domain and anyone can make, use, or sell it without permission. In pharmaceuticals, this opens the door to generic manufacturers and lower prices. Patent infringement claims also end, because there is no longer an exclusive right to defend.

Expiration is less an ending than a handoff. The original bargain of the patent system was always limited exclusivity in exchange for public disclosure, and the public domain is where that disclosure finally pays off for everyone else. A generic manufacturer can launch a lower-cost version of a drug. A startup can build on a method that was off-limits a year earlier. A researcher can study, adapt, and improve technology without negotiating a license.

That handoff is uneven, though. Plenty of intellectual property goes dormant long before it expires, sitting unused in portfolios because the patent owner never commercialized it and competitors could not touch it. Expired and underused patents represent a deep reservoir of knowledge for anyone willing to mine it, which is where open science and open access become useful. Pooling expired and openly licensed work lets interdisciplinary teams move ideas toward real industrial application faster than any single patent holder could alone.
